Punahou’s Kono fifth at Rolex tournament

Punahou's Stephanie Kono shot 5-over-par 75 yesterday to place fifth in the girls division at the American Junior Golf Association's Rolex Tournament of Champions at Hiwan Golf Club in Evergreen, Colo.

Moanalua's Tadd Fujikawa shot 3-over 73 and finished in a four-way tie for 16th place in the boys division.

Kono's only two birdies of the final round came on the second and 15th holes, both par-5s, and she closed the four-day tournament at 12-over 292.

Ashleigh Simon of South Africa also shot 75 yesterday and hung on to win the tournament by one stroke over Arizona's Taylore Karle with a total of 6-over 286.

Fujikawa shot even-par on the front nine yesterday, then went 3 over on the back to close at 289.

Philip Francis of Scottsdale, Ariz., won the boys title by a single stroke over Peter Uihlein at 278.

Fujikawa is among six Hawaii players entered in the U.S. Amateur Public Links Championship, which begins today at Gold Mountain Golf Club in Bremerton, Wash.

Other with tee-times this morning are Sean Maekawa of Paauilo, Chan Kim of Honolulu, Casey Watabu of Kapaa, Lee Sakugawa of Wailuku and Kevin Shimomura of Lahaina.
